Puddledock Woods Camping











/1.197575616532959,51.32752080665785,12,0,0/376x277@2x)
- Quiet and rural park in the middle of a two-acre woodland
- A 20-minute drive from Canterbury and 25 minutes from Margate
- Barbecues, campfires and dogs allowed; walks straight from the site

Primitive grass and earth tent campsite (woodland, wild)
Liked Nothing
Disliked Dont be fooled by the pictures online like me. This site is essentially a tiny patch of trees next to a traveller site, the wood doubles up as camp site and junk yard/dumping ground. There are dumped cars everywhere and a rusted out, half broken down bus is in view pretty much where ever you pitch. If you dont believe me just look at the satalite view on maps.
The site has a small stream between it and the traveller site which is full of junk and rubbish.
As you drive in its all just abandoned trailers, caravans and dumped rusting out cars. The parking area is just a patch of grass next to some abandoned trailers.
The woods are just left with old camp equipment dotted about that has been left by previous campers.
On our arrival the site felt abandoned and despite pitch up saying "last 1 booking available" there was no one around, the shop/bar areas had no one in them and looked abandoned as well. Eventually a staff member appeared from a mechanics workshop/garage covered in grease, didnt ask who we were or if we had booked and told us to ignore the bus and pitch up wherever.
Genuinely felt unsafe to leave my car here overnight and certainly wouldn't dream of leaving my tent and camping kit here while going out for the day.
We arrived walked around the site and then got back in our car to book somewhere else. Really surprised that Pitch Up even advertise this camp site.

Great camping in the woods but the toilets need more looking after
Primitive grass and earth tent campsite (woodland, wild)
Liked Great woods to stay in. Completely dark at night and can hear woodpeckers and owls. Rope swings in the woods for kids to play on.
Outdoor showers are lovely. Brilliant local lager on tap and the owners are friendly and helpful.
Disliked Toilets need regular cleaning which was not happening. One hand sink in a toilet has no water connected so can’t wash hands. A bottle of hand sanitizer would be good there.
Soap and toilet roll regularly running out. Maybe it was someone’s job who wasn’t there to keep an eye on the toilets and everyone assumed someone else was doing it. A regular clean and check on soap and toilet roll would have made a big difference.
The bar is great but needs a tidy up. It’s next to a garage and with the door left open the car fumes could sometimes be smelt in the bar.
There are also lots of broken down cars around in various stages of neglect or being repaired. Some of them are quite quirky and could be a bit of a feature but it feels a bit chaotic.
At the entrance it kind of needs to decide if it’s a campsite or a breakers yard.
It is a lovely site but needs a bit of a spruce up around the bar and toilets.
